Abstract

This research was conducted to find out about the effect of the use of visual aids on the understanding of pulley material in science subjects in SDN Pecoro 3 . This research method uses an experimental design model, namely a one-shot case study. The number of samples tested was 24 students, and the value of learning outcomes was used as the variable being tested. Then it was found that learning using visual aids had a different learning outcome value than using the lecture method, and tended to increase. The results were obtained after testing the hypothesis on the results of student learning scores, which were obtained through tests after conducting learning experiments using visual aids. The choice of pulley material itself is because many students still do not understand how the pulley system works when applied in everyday life. Then to find out the role of the use of visual aids, is it able to foster students' interest in learning. As well as to find out how big the class differences are after learning using teaching aids.
